Job Summary:

The Commercial Lines Account Manager - Farm will service new and existing accounts by marketing insurance coverages with review of coverage placement. Serves as insurance consultant to the farm/ranch personal and commercial lines clients with the primary responsibility for retention.

Job

Duties & Responsibilities:

* Work with client/sales executive in gathering marketing data for new and renewal quotes

* Obtain quotes from carriers for new and existing business

* Negotiate pricing and coverages with carrier representatives as needed

* Review and prepare coverage analysis through the proposal creation process

* Provide exceptional service with accuracy and timeliness in processing all policy documents

* Develop and maintain relationships with carrier representatives and remain educated on carrier appetites

* Advocates for client in the marketing process to obtain the best outcomes

* Maintain quotes, client/carrier correspondence and updated client information in agency management system

* Advanced knowledge of carrier online systems for obtaining quotes, loss runs, billing information, policy documents, etc.

* Primarily responsible for maintaining current receivable status for assigned clients

* Proactive efforts to collect receivables more than 30 days past-due should be undertaken, with each unresolved circumstance documented and reported to accounting

* Acts as liaison between clients and insurance carriers to resolve service issues

* May be involved in training of new hires

* Identifies opportunities for cross-sell and up-sell

* Support client to resolve any carrier claim challenges in concert with the HUB claims team

* Broaden knowledge of the industry with continuing education

* Follows HUB Broker Standards policies/procedures

* Other duties may be assigned

* This job does not have any supervisory responsibilities.
